Any member can have possession of a club firearm. Plod just ask that the place where it is normally stored is declared and recorded on the ticket. Each club firearm can be stored at a different members address. Club ammo can be stored too at a reasonable level for club use. This is all in addition to your personal agreed limits. The bit that needs clarification, is the purchase of ammunition by a declared keeper for club purposes? Will ask this question tomorrow...

Club ammo - mmmm, not sure about that one, particularly if you have an FAC and you've got club ammo in a calibre that isn't on your ticket, or you don't have an FAC and you're storing firearms or ammo.
Section 15(1), Firearms (Amendment) Act 1988 is the only bit of law on this:
(1) Subject to subsection (4) below, a member of a rifle club approved by the Secretary of State [F2or the Scottish Ministers (by virtue of provision made under section 63 of the Scotland Act 1998)] may, without holding a firearm certificate, have in his possession a rifle and ammunition when engaged as a member of the club in connection with target shooting.
...
(4) The application of subsection (1) above to members of an approved rifle club may—
(a)be excluded in relation to the club, or
(b)be restricted to target shooting with specified types of rifle,
by limitations contained in the approval.

In our club I am the chairman and hold the club FAC.
What we have done previously (when the previous chairman held the FAC) is when we were running low on ammo one of the personal FAC holding members would take the club FAC with a letter of authority to an RFD. We did this with 3 different RFDs, one was the NSRA Shop.
The letter stated the named member had authority to purchase a specified quantity of each ammo type required, some of the RFDs held onto the letter others didn't.

We had a discussion on here last year on the subject of multiple club facs, of course I can't find it (will keep trying) one club had multiple tickets so different members could deal with different club sections (rifles, black powder, shotguns IIRC).
One thing to note is - regardless of whether it's common or not - there's nothing in law that precludes multiple club fac's. I've read the acts and guidance top to bottom of late and there's nothing other than the mutiple officers requirement on the HO club approval (came in Jan 15) that comes close.
